首页 办公 正文

excel筛选不选第一行

我们经常需要使用筛选功能来快速定位需要的数据,筛选器会把表头也包含在筛选范围内,本篇文章将为大家分享如何在Excel中实现筛选不选第一行的方法。在进行筛选操作时,功能来进行筛选操作。我们需要手动选择需要筛选的数据区域。...

在Excel中,我们经常需要使用筛选功能来快速定位需要的数据,但是默认情况下,筛选器会把表头也包含在筛选范围内,这就让我们不得不手动删除第一行筛选器。本篇文章将为大家分享如何在Excel中实现筛选不选第一行的方法。

1. 将第一行作为表头

在Excel中,我们通常会将第一行作为表头来描述数据。因此,在进行筛选操作时,可以利用这个特点,将第一行作为筛选范围之外的部分。

2. 使用“自动筛选”功能

在Excel中,可以通过使用“自动筛选”功能来进行筛选操作。但是需要注意的是,如果选择了整个表格,那么Excel会默认将第一行也包含在筛选范围内。因此,我们需要手动选择需要筛选的数据区域。

3. 使用“高级筛选”功能

Excel中还提供了“高级筛选”功能,可以灵活地进行数据筛选。在使用此功能时,选择要筛选的列和条件后,需要勾选“区域包含列标头”,然后点击“确定”即可实现筛选不选第一行。

4. 使用VBA代码

如果经常需要进行相同的筛选操作,可以使用VBA代码来自动化实现。具体操作方式可以参考以下代码示例:

Sub FilterData()

With ActiveSheet

.AutoFilterMode = False

lRow = .Cells(.Rows.Count, 1).End(xlUp).Row

Set filtrationRange = .Range("A2:A" & lRow)

filtrationRange.AutoFilter Field:=1, Criteria1:="criteria"

End With

End Sub

通过以上四种方法,可以实现在Excel中进行筛选时不选第一行的效果。对于经常需要进行数据分析和处理的人来说,掌握这些技巧能够提高工作效率,并且更加方便快捷地完成任务。

本文转载自互联网,如有侵权,联系删除